L'Olimpiade, an opera, as perform'd at the King's-Theatre in the Hay-Market [electronic resource] : The music by several eminent masters. Executed under the direction of Signor Guglielmi, a neapolitan composer. The poetry of this opera originally belonged to metastasio; to which, without prejudice to the principal action, an entire new turn is given, some airs changed, different parts of the recitative altered, the quintetto added in the second act, and the duet in the third.
1769
